Abstract
本發明有關於一種指尖陀螺,其包含有二個中間塊及八個角塊,二個中間塊以可相對樞轉的方式相互連接,且其中一個中間塊的內部設有一個軸承,使得二個中間塊透過軸承共同繞著一個第一軸向旋轉,八個角塊以兩兩成對的方式樞設於二個中間塊的四個角落,使得每一中間塊能帶動四個角塊一起繞著第一軸向旋轉,而且,每一對角塊能共同繞著一個垂直第一軸向之第二軸向相對二個中間塊樞轉。藉此,本發明之指尖陀螺結合了雙階魔術方塊的功能,讓玩法更多元更複雜,進而達到提高趣味性的效果。The present invention relates to a fingertip top, which includes two middle blocks and eight corner blocks, the two middle blocks are connected to each other in a relatively pivotable manner, and one of the middle blocks is provided with a bearing inside, so that the two The two middle blocks rotate together around a first axis through a bearing. The eight corner blocks are pivoted on the four corners of the two middle blocks in pairs, so that each middle block can drive the four corner blocks together. It rotates around the first axis, and each of the diagonal blocks can jointly pivot relative to the two middle blocks around a second axis perpendicular to the first axis. In this way, the fingertip top of the present invention combines the function of the two-stage magic cube, which makes the gameplay more diverse and complex, and thus achieves the effect of enhancing the fun.
Description
本發明與指尖陀螺有關,特別是指一種結合雙階魔術方塊玩法之指尖陀螺。The present invention is related to a fingertip top, and particularly refers to a fingertip top combined with a two-level magic cube game.
指尖陀螺為近年來相當流行的一種玩具,其結構主要包含有一個陀螺主體,陀螺主體的中間位置設置有一個軸承,軸承的二端分別對應地設置一個護蓋,使用者以二根手指捏住二個護蓋,再予以轉動陀螺主體,陀螺主體即可藉由軸承的設置而在使用者的二根手指之間旋轉,但是實際上這樣的玩法過於單調,對於使用者來說可能把玩一段時間之後就不想玩了。The fingertip top is a popular toy in recent years. Its structure mainly includes a top body. The middle of the top body is provided with a bearing. The two ends of the bearing are respectively provided with a cover. The user pinches with two fingers. Hold the two protective covers, and then rotate the main body of the gyro. The main body of the gyro can be rotated between the two fingers of the user by the setting of the bearing, but in fact, this kind of gameplay is too monotonous and may be played for the user. I don't want to play after time.
為了增加趣味性,CN207076098U專利案揭露出一種五軸一階魔方,其包含有一個中心塊、五個中間塊和五個相鄰塊,中心塊設有一個中心轉動軸,中心轉動軸的二端分別設有一個手指按捏盤,利用二根手指捏住按捏盤即可作為指尖陀螺使用。此外,中心塊以放射狀方式設置五個位於同一個平面的軸頭,五個中間塊分別以可轉動的方式配合在五個軸頭上,五個相鄰塊則是分別卡配於相鄰二個中間塊之間,如此當一個中間塊及與其相鄰的二個相鄰塊一起轉動90度的情況下,相鄰的另外一個中間塊及與其相鄰的另外一個相鄰塊還能夠轉動90度,藉此提供類似魔術方塊的玩法。然而,由於前述專利案為單層結構,整體的玩法及變化形式會受到限制,所以對於提高趣味性的效果仍未臻理想。In order to increase the interest, the CN207076098U patent case reveals a five-axis first-order Rubik's Cube, which includes a central block, five intermediate blocks and five adjacent blocks. The central block is provided with a central rotating shaft and two ends of the central rotating shaft. Each is provided with a finger pinch plate, and the pinch plate can be used as a finger tip top by pinching the pinch plate with two fingers. In addition, the central block is provided with five shaft heads located on the same plane in a radial manner, the five middle blocks are respectively rotatably fitted on the five shaft heads, and the five adjacent blocks are respectively clamped to the adjacent two. Between two intermediate blocks, so when one intermediate block and its adjacent two adjacent blocks rotate 90 degrees together, another adjacent intermediate block and another adjacent adjacent block can also rotate 90 degrees. Degree, thereby providing a gameplay similar to a magic cube. However, since the aforementioned patent case is a single-layer structure, the overall gameplay and variations will be limited, so the effect of enhancing the fun is still not ideal.
本發明之主要目的在於提供一種指尖陀螺,其具有雙階魔術方塊的功能,使玩法更加的多元化,以提高趣味性。The main purpose of the present invention is to provide a fingertip spinning top, which has the function of a two-stage magic cube, which makes the gameplay more diversified and enhances the fun.
為了達成上述主要目的,本發明之指尖陀螺包含有一個中間組件、一個中心組件,以及多個角塊組件。In order to achieve the above-mentioned main purpose, the fingertip top of the present invention includes an intermediate component, a center component, and a plurality of corner block components.
而該中間組件具有一個第一中間塊及一個第二中間塊,該第一、第二中間塊以可相對樞轉的方式相互連接,使得兩者能繞著一第一軸向相對轉動,該第一中間塊之中央具有一個貫穿二相對側面之第一軸孔,該第二中間塊之中央具有一個貫穿二相對側面之第二軸孔,該第一、第二軸孔同軸相通,此外,該第一中間塊之外周緣具有多個第一弧槽,該等第一弧槽相對該第一軸孔呈等間隔環狀排列,該第二中間塊之外周緣具有多個第二弧槽,該等第二弧槽相對該第二軸孔呈等間隔環狀排列,其中,任一該第一弧槽與任一該第二弧槽為一對一地相互對接而形成一個樞接槽。The intermediate assembly has a first intermediate block and a second intermediate block. The first and second intermediate blocks are connected to each other in a relatively pivotable manner, so that the two can rotate relative to each other around a first axis. The center of the first middle block has a first shaft hole penetrating through two opposite side surfaces, the center of the second middle block has a second shaft hole penetrating through two opposite sides, the first and second shaft holes are in coaxial communication, in addition, The outer periphery of the first middle block is provided with a plurality of first arc grooves, the first arc grooves are arranged in a ring shape at equal intervals relative to the first shaft hole, and the outer periphery of the second middle block is provided with a plurality of second arc grooves , The second arc grooves are arranged in an equally spaced ring shape with respect to the second shaft hole, wherein any one of the first arc grooves and any one of the second arc grooves abut each other one to one to form a pivot groove .
而該中心組件具有一個第一中心件、一個第二中心件及一個軸承,該第一中心件具有一個第一盤體與一根連接該第一盤體之第一軸桿,該第一盤體位於該第一中間塊之第一軸孔的一端,該第二中心件具有一個第二盤體與一根連接該第二盤體之第二軸桿,該第二盤體位於該第二中間塊之第二軸孔的一端,該第二軸桿接設於該第一中間件之第一軸桿,該軸承被該第一中心件之第一軸桿與該第二中心件之第二軸桿所支撐,藉以允許該第一、第二中間塊共同繞著該第一軸向旋轉。The center assembly has a first center piece, a second center piece, and a bearing. The first center piece has a first disc body and a first shaft connecting the first disc body. The first disc The body is located at one end of the first shaft hole of the first intermediate block, the second center piece has a second disc body and a second shaft connecting the second disc body, the second disc body is located in the second One end of the second shaft hole of the intermediate block, the second shaft is connected to the first shaft of the first intermediate piece, and the bearing is supported by the first shaft of the first central piece and the second shaft of the second central piece. Supported by two shafts, the first and second intermediate blocks are allowed to rotate together around the first axis.
而各該角塊組件具有一個第一角塊與一個第二角塊,該第一、第二角塊相互並排,該第一角塊具有一個第一弧形部,該第一角塊之第一弧形部設於該第一中間塊之第一弧槽內,使該第一角塊能跟著該第一中間塊繞著該第一軸向旋轉,該第二角塊具有一個第二弧形部,該第二角塊之第二弧形部設於該第二中間塊之第二弧槽內,使該第二角塊能跟著該第二中間塊繞著該第一軸向旋轉,此外,該第一角塊之第一弧形部與該第二角塊之第二弧形部相互對接而共同形成一個樞接部,各該角塊組件之樞接部可樞轉地設於該中間組件之樞接槽內,使各該角塊組件能相對該中間組件繞著一個垂直該第一軸向之第二軸向旋轉。Each of the corner block components has a first corner block and a second corner block, the first and second corner blocks are arranged side by side, the first corner block has a first arc-shaped portion, and the first corner block is An arc-shaped portion is provided in the first arc groove of the first intermediate block, so that the first corner block can rotate with the first intermediate block around the first axial direction, and the second corner block has a second arc The second arc-shaped portion of the second corner block is arranged in the second arc groove of the second middle block, so that the second corner block can rotate with the second middle block around the first axis, In addition, the first arc-shaped portion of the first corner block and the second arc-shaped portion of the second corner block are butted with each other to jointly form a pivoting portion, and the pivoting portion of each corner block assembly is pivotably disposed at In the pivotal groove of the middle assembly, each corner block assembly can rotate relative to the middle assembly around a second axis perpendicular to the first axis.
由上述可知,本發明之指尖陀螺不僅可以單純作為指尖螺陀使用,另外在本身結構上兼具雙階魔術方塊的功能,如此即可讓玩法更多元更複雜,進而達到提高趣味性的效果。It can be seen from the above that the fingertip gyro of the present invention can not only be used as a fingertip gyro, but also has the function of a two-stage magic cube in its structure. This can make the gameplay more diverse and more complicated, thereby enhancing the fun. Effect.
較佳地,該中心組件之軸承設於該第一中間塊之第一軸孔內,且被該第一中心件之第一軸桿與該第二中心件之第二軸桿所支撐;而該第一中間塊之外周緣具有多個第一延伸槽,各該第一延伸槽自一該第一弧槽朝遠離該第二中間塊的方向水平延伸而出,該第二中間塊之外周緣具有多個第二延伸槽,各該第二延伸槽自一該第二弧槽朝遠離該第一中間塊的方向水平延伸而出,該等第一延伸槽與該等第二延伸槽之間一對一地彼此相對,且該等第一延伸槽與該等第二延伸槽內分別設有一個第一磁性件;各該第一、第二角塊內分別設有一個第二磁性件。藉此,當該等第二磁性件被該等第一磁性件所吸附時,該等角塊組件會保持定位而不會相對該中間組件任意轉動。Preferably, the bearing of the center assembly is arranged in the first shaft hole of the first intermediate block, and is supported by the first shaft of the first center piece and the second shaft of the second center piece; and The outer periphery of the first middle block has a plurality of first extension grooves, each of the first extension grooves horizontally extends from a first arc groove in a direction away from the second middle block, and the outer circumference of the second middle block The rim has a plurality of second extending grooves, each of the second extending grooves horizontally extending from a second arc groove in a direction away from the first intermediate block, and one of the first extending grooves and the second extending grooves They are opposite to each other one to one, and each of the first extension grooves and the second extension grooves is provided with a first magnetic member; each of the first and second corner blocks is provided with a second magnetic member respectively . Thereby, when the second magnetic parts are adsorbed by the first magnetic parts, the corner block components will remain in position and will not rotate freely relative to the intermediate component.
較佳地, 該第一中間塊自該第一軸孔之孔壁一體地徑向延伸出一個擋緣,該第一中心件之第一軸桿具有一個連接該第一盤體之大徑部與一個連接該大徑部之小徑部,該大徑部與該小徑部之交界處形成一個肩部,該第二中心件之第二軸桿具有一個桿孔,該桿孔被該第一中心件之第一軸桿的小徑部所穿設。此外,該軸承具有一個內環、一個外環及多個設於該內、外環之間的滾珠,該軸承之內環套設於該第一中心件之第一軸桿的小徑部且抵靠在該第一中心件之肩部與該第二中心件之第二軸桿的端面之間,該軸承之外環抵靠於該第一中間塊之擋緣,使該軸承完成組裝定位。Preferably, the first intermediate block integrally extends radially from the hole wall of the first shaft hole with a retaining edge, and the first shaft of the first center piece has a large diameter portion connected to the first disc body And a small-diameter part connecting the large-diameter part, a shoulder is formed at the junction of the large-diameter part and the small-diameter part, the second shaft of the second center piece has a rod hole, and the rod hole is The small diameter part of the first shaft of a center piece is penetrated. In addition, the bearing has an inner ring, an outer ring, and a plurality of balls arranged between the inner and outer rings. The inner ring of the bearing is sleeved on the small diameter portion of the first shaft of the first center piece. Abutting between the shoulder of the first center piece and the end surface of the second shaft of the second center piece, the outer ring of the bearing abuts against the retaining edge of the first intermediate block, so that the bearing is assembled and positioned .
較佳地,該第一中間塊自本身朝該第二中間塊之一側面沿著該第一軸孔之軸向朝該第二中間塊一體地延伸出一個第一環部,該第一環部具有一個螺孔,該第二中間塊自該第二軸孔之孔壁一體地徑向延伸出一個第二環部,該第二中間塊之第二環部以可轉動的方式套設於該第一中間塊之第一環部。此外,該中間組件更具有一個墊片與一根螺絲,該墊片抵靠於該第一中間塊之第一環部與該第二中間塊之第二環部,且該墊片具有一個穿孔,該螺絲穿經該墊片之穿孔且螺設於該第一中間塊之第一環部的螺孔,使該第一、第二中間塊以可轉動的方式組裝在一起。Preferably, the first intermediate block integrally extends a first ring portion from itself toward a side surface of the second intermediate block along the axial direction of the first shaft hole toward the second intermediate block, and the first ring The portion has a screw hole, the second intermediate block radially extends a second ring portion integrally from the hole wall of the second shaft hole, and the second ring portion of the second intermediate block is rotatably sleeved on The first ring portion of the first intermediate block. In addition, the intermediate component further has a washer and a screw, the washer abuts against the first ring portion of the first intermediate block and the second ring portion of the second intermediate block, and the washer has a through hole The screw passes through the perforation of the gasket and is screwed into the screw hole of the first ring portion of the first intermediate block, so that the first and second intermediate blocks are assembled together in a rotatable manner.
較佳地,各該第一角塊具有一個連接該第一弧形部之第一擋止部,各該第二角塊具有一個連接該第二弧形部之第二擋止部,各該第一角塊的第一擋止部與各該第二角塊之第二擋止部相互對接而形成一個擋塊,該擋塊的外徑大於該樞接槽的外徑,如此藉由該擋塊與該樞接槽之槽口周圍的相互干涉來防止各該角塊組件自該第一中間塊分離。Preferably, each of the first corner pieces has a first stopping portion connected to the first arc-shaped portion, each of the second corner pieces has a second stopping portion connected to the second arc-shaped portion, and each of the The first stop portion of the first corner block and the second stop portion of each of the second corner blocks abut each other to form a stop block, the outer diameter of the stop block is larger than the outer diameter of the pivot groove, so that the The interference between the stop block and the periphery of the notch of the pivotal groove prevents each corner block assembly from separating from the first intermediate block.

請參閱圖1、圖2及圖5,本發明之指尖陀螺10包含有一個中間組件11、一個中心組件13,以及多個角塊組件14(在本實施例中為四個)。Please refer to FIG. 1, FIG. 2 and FIG. 5. The
中間組件11具有一個呈矩形之第一中間塊20及一個呈矩形之第二中間塊30,其中:The
第一中間塊20具有一個第一軸孔21、四個第一弧槽22及四個第一延伸槽23,第一軸孔21位於第一中間塊20之中央且貫穿第一中間塊20之內、外二側面,如圖3所示,四個第一弧槽22位於第一中間塊20之四個側面的中央,使四個第一弧槽22相對於第一軸孔21呈等間隔環狀排列,四個第一延伸槽23位於第一中間塊20之四個側面的中央且分別跟一個第一弧槽22連通,每一個第一延伸槽23從第一弧槽22之中央朝遠離第二中間塊30的方向水平延伸而出。此外,如圖2所示,第一中間塊20更具有一個第一環部24與一個擋緣26,第一環部24自第一中間塊20朝第二中間塊之一側面沿著第一軸孔21之軸向朝第二中間塊30一體地延伸而出,且第一環部24具有二個螺孔25,擋緣26自第一軸孔21之孔壁一體地徑向延伸而出。The
第二中間塊30具有一個第二軸孔31、四個第二弧槽32及四個第二延伸槽33,第二軸孔31位於第二中間塊30之中央且貫穿第二中間塊30之內、外二側面,如圖3所示,四個第二弧槽32位於第二中間塊30之四個側面的中央,使四個第二弧槽32相對於第二軸孔31呈等間隔環狀排列,四個第二延伸槽33位於第二中間塊30之四個側面的中央且分別跟一個第二弧槽32連通,每一個第二延伸槽33從第二弧槽32之中央朝遠離第一中間塊20的方向水平延伸而出。此外,如圖2所示,第二中間塊30具有一個第二環部34,第二環部34自第二軸孔31之孔壁一體地徑向延伸而出。The
在組裝時,如圖2及圖5所示,第二中間塊30以第二環部34套設於第一中間塊20之第一環部24,接著用一個墊片35同時抵靠於第一中間塊20之第一環部24與第二中間塊30之第二環部34,然後用二根螺絲37穿過墊片35之二個穿孔36且鎖設於第一中間塊20之第一環部24的螺孔25內,如此即完成第一中間塊20與第二中間塊30的組裝。在完成組裝之後,第一中間塊20與第二中間塊30便能繞著一個第一軸向A1相對轉動,而且,如圖3所示,四個第一弧槽22與四個第二弧槽32一對一地相互對接而共同形成一個呈圓形之樞接槽12。During assembly, as shown in Figures 2 and 5, the second
中心組件13具有一個第一中心件40、一個第二中心件50及一個軸承60,其中:The
第一中心件40具有一個第一盤體41與一根第一軸桿42,如圖2及圖5所示,第一軸桿42具有一個大徑部43與一個小徑部44,大徑部43之一端連接第一盤體41,大徑部43之另一端連接小徑部44,使得大徑部43與小徑部44之交界處形成一個肩部45。The
第二中心件50具有一個第二盤體51與一根第二軸桿52,如圖2及圖5所示,第二軸桿52之一端連接第二盤體51,且第二軸桿52具有一個桿孔53。The
軸承60具有一個內環61、一個外環62及多個設於內環61與外環62之間之滾珠63。The
在配合中間組件11進行組裝時,如圖2及圖5所示,軸承60設於第一中間塊20之第一軸孔21內,且軸承60之外環62抵靠於第一中間塊20之擋緣26,接著第一中心件40之第一軸桿42的小徑部44穿過軸承60之內環61且插設於第二中心件50之第二軸桿52的桿孔53內,使軸承60之內環61抵靠在第一中心件40之第一軸桿42的肩部45與第二中心件50之第二軸桿52的端面之間而完成軸承60的定位。如此在組裝完成之後,第一中心件40之第一盤體41位於第一中間塊20之第一軸孔21的一端,且第二中心件50之第二盤體51位於第二中間塊30之第二軸孔31的一端,當以二根手指捏住第一盤體41與第二盤體51時,即可透過軸承60讓第一中間塊20與第二中間塊30共同繞著第一軸向A1旋轉。When assembling with the
四個角塊組件14位於中間組件11的四個角落,每一個角塊組件14具有一個第一角塊70及一個第二角塊80,如圖2及圖3所示,其中:The four
第一角塊70之一側面具有一個第一弧形部71與一個呈弧形之第一擋止部72,第一擋止部72連接於第一弧形部71之末端,且第一擋止部72的外徑大於第一弧形部71的外徑及第一中間塊20之第一弧槽22的外徑。One side of the
第二角塊80之一側面具有一個第二弧形部81與一個呈弧形之第二擋止部82,第二擋止部82連接於第二弧形部81之末端,且第二擋止部82的外徑大於第二弧形部81的外徑及第二中間塊30之第二弧槽32的外徑。One side of the
在配合中間組件11進行組裝時,如圖3及圖6所示,在第一中間塊20與第二中間塊30利用二根螺絲37組裝在一起之前,先將第一角塊70之第一弧形部71與第二角塊80之第二弧形部81分別嵌設於第一中間塊20之第一弧槽22及第二中間塊30之第二弧槽32內,然後依照前述步驟將第一中間塊20與第二中間塊30組裝在一起之後,第一角塊70與第二角塊80會相互並排,此時的第一角塊70與第二角塊80一方面可以分別跟著第一中間塊20與第二中間塊30繞著第一軸向A1旋轉(如圖9及圖10所示),另一方面,如圖2及圖3所示,第一角塊70之第一弧形部71與第二角塊80之第二弧形部81相互對接而形成一個呈圓形之樞接部15,第一角塊70與第二角塊80便能利用此一樞接部15與中間組件11之樞接槽12形成樞接關係,使角塊組件14能相對中間組件11繞著一個垂直第一軸向A1之第二軸向A2旋轉(如圖11及圖12所示)。此外,如圖2、圖3及圖6所示,第一角塊70之第一擋止部72與第二角塊80之第二擋止部82亦會相互對接而形成一個呈圓形的擋塊16,第一角塊70與第二角塊80便能利用此一擋塊16與中間組件11之樞接槽12的槽口周圍形成干涉,以防止角塊組件14脫離。When assembling with the
為了讓各個角塊組件14有定位效果而不會任意轉動,如圖3所示,第一中間塊20之各個第一延伸槽23及第二中間塊30之各個第二延伸槽33內分別設置一個第一磁性件17(如磁鐵),各個角塊組件14更具有一個第一蓋板73與一個第二蓋板83,第一蓋板73具有一個第一板體74與一個連接第一板體74之第一臂部75,第二蓋板83具有一個第二板體84與一個連接第二板體84之第二臂部85,第一板體74與第二板體84相互抵接且位於第一角塊70與第二角塊80之間,第一臂部75與第二臂部85分別伸入第一角塊70與第二角塊80內,且第一臂部75與第二臂部85內分別設有一個第二磁性件18(如磁鐵)。藉此,當該等第二磁性件18被該等第一磁性件17所吸附時,如圖7所示,該等角塊組件14會保持定位而不會相對中間組件11任意轉動,一旦該等角塊組件14所受到的外力克服了該等第一磁性件17與該等第二磁性件18之間的吸附力量時,該等角塊組件14即可相對中間組件11轉動,如圖8所示(在圖8中顯示該等角塊組件14相對中間組件11轉動90度的狀態)。In order to make each
由上述可知,本發明之指尖陀螺10具有多種不同玩法:如圖1及圖4所示,將第一中間塊20與第二中間塊30保持相同的角度位置,使第一角塊70與第二角塊80相互並排,接著用二根手指捏住第一盤體41與第二盤體51,即可讓中間組件11及各個角塊組件14共同繞著第一軸向A1旋轉;再如圖9及圖10所示,將第二中間塊30相對第一中間塊20旋轉45度,使第一角塊70與第二角塊80相互錯開,接著用二根手指捏住第一盤體41與第二盤體51,亦可讓中間組件11及各個角塊組件14共同繞著第一軸向A1旋轉;再如圖11及圖12所示,將第一中間塊20與第二中間塊30保持相同的角度位置,再將各個角塊組件14相對中間組件11旋轉90度,接著用二根手指捏住第一盤體41與第二盤體51,亦可讓中間組件11及各個角塊組件14共同繞著第一軸向A1旋轉。It can be seen from the above that the fingertip top 10 of the present invention has a variety of different ways of playing: as shown in Figures 1 and 4, the first intermediate block 20 and the second intermediate block 30 are kept at the same angular position, so that the first corner block 70 and The second corner blocks 80 are arranged side by side, and then pinch the first disc body 41 and the second disc body 51 with two fingers, so that the middle assembly 11 and each corner block assembly 14 can rotate around the first axis A1 together; As shown in Figures 9 and 10, the second intermediate block 30 is rotated 45 degrees relative to the first intermediate block 20, so that the first corner block 70 and the second corner block 80 are staggered from each other, and then pinch the first plate with two fingers The body 41 and the second disc body 51 can also allow the middle assembly 11 and each corner block assembly 14 to rotate together around the first axis A1; then, as shown in FIGS. 11 and 12, the first middle block 20 and the second The intermediate block 30 maintains the same angular position, and then rotates each corner block assembly 14 relative to the intermediate assembly 11 by 90 degrees, and then pinches the first disc body 41 and the second disc body 51 with two fingers, so that the intermediate assembly 11 and Each corner block assembly 14 rotates together around the first axis A1.
若不作為指尖陀螺使用時,也可以拿來作為雙階魔術方塊使用,亦即可以選擇讓第一中間塊20及四個第一角塊70與第二中間塊30及四個第二角塊80之間相對持續轉動(如圖9及圖10所示),或者讓其中一個或多個角塊組件14相對中間組件11持續轉動(如圖11及圖12所示)。If it is not used as a fingertip gyro, it can also be used as a two-tier magic cube, that is, you can choose to have the first
綜上所陳,本發明之指尖陀螺10不僅可以單純作為指尖螺陀使用,另外在本身結構上兼具雙階魔術方塊的功能,讓玩法更多元更複雜,進而達到提高趣味性的效果。此外,如圖13所示,中間組件11的外表面及各個角塊組件14的外表面可以進一步設置不同顏色或花紋的圖樣90、92,讓本發明之指尖陀螺10在把玩時產生特別的視覺效果。In summary, the
